While it’s been years since we heard Channing Tatum was to play the Ragin’ Cajun from Marvel’s X-men comics that movie appears to be D.O.A. But fear not Gambit fans! A new fan-made film called Gambit Play For Keeps hit the internet this week and the production levels are as high as any X-men film you’ve gone to the theaters to see. With appearances from Magik, and Rogue of course, a high-stakes card game goes sideways and the mutants have to fight their way out in this 20 minute joyride featuring Actor, Instagram Hottie and International Model Nick Bateman as the card throwing t’ief.
